Course Content

• Hydrogel Chemistry for Filtration Applications
• Polymer Synthesis and Characterization for Hydrogels
• Advanced Hydrogel Design for Targeted Filtration
• Membrane Technology and Hydrogel Integration
• Filtration Mechanisms and Performance Evaluation
• Applications of Hydrogels in Water Purification
• Biofouling and Hydrogel-based Antifouling Strategies
• Scale-up and Manufacturing of Hydrogel Membranes
• Regulatory Aspects and Commercialization of Hydrogel Filters

Career path

Career Role (Hydrogel Filtration) Description
Research Scientist (Hydrogel Membranes) Develop novel hydrogel-based filtration technologies for water purification and other applications. Requires strong understanding of material science and chemistry.
Process Engineer (Hydrogel Filtration) Optimize and scale-up hydrogel filtration processes, ensuring efficient and cost-effective production. Focus on industrial implementation and process design.
Application Specialist (Water Treatment Hydrogels) Provide technical support to clients, demonstrating the effectiveness of hydrogel filtration systems in various applications. Strong communication and problem-solving skills are crucial.
Regulatory Affairs Specialist (Biomedical Hydrogels) Ensure compliance with relevant regulations for hydrogel-based medical filtration devices. Expertise in regulatory frameworks and documentation is needed.
